Over 30 traditional and modern Norwegian knitwear patterns for all seasons and all the family. From Internet sensation Lasse Matberg.
Discover and knit over 30 items for men, women and children, designed for all occasions and seasons, inspired by the Vikings’ warm, all-weather garments. From tough-wearing sweaters and outerwear to elegant cardigans and jackets, all have made been made in stunning Scandinavian style. Hats, mittens, scarves and seat pads which match the sweaters and are easy to knit, can also be found in the book. Whether you love traditional, Nordic colorwork patterns and cables, or modern, textured knits, there is something for everyone.
It is divided into five parts:
The Best Everyday Knits-Rugged Knits-Stylish Knits-Norse Sweaters-Cosy Accessories
Lasse L. Matberg comes from a family who, for generations, have been working to create beautiful, quality crafted items by hand – father and grandfather were craftsmen, and mother and grandmother often worked hard knitting warm garments for the whole family. Viking Knitting is a tribute to good-quality, practical needlework, inspired by the Vikings’ warm, all-weather garments.
The patterns are made in collaboration with Strikkemekka, and modeled by Lasse and his family.
192 pages. Hardcover. 10.7 in H | 8.3 in W

Lindsborg, Kansas, also known as “Little Sweden, USA,” was settled by Swedish immigrants in the 1860s. Lindsborg and its beautiful downtown – lined with small retail shops, restaurants, coffee shops, and galleries – are enjoyed by visitors from throughout the world. Nestled in the Smoky Valley, Lindsborg is world-renowned for its Swedish heritage and love of the arts. Locals and visitors love celebrating Swedish traditions year-round, including St. Lucia, Midsummer (Midsommar), King Knut’s Day, and even Våffeldagen!
